    If you can't afford a vet, try contacting these guys. They are a Reptile Rescue in Cinncinati, but they may know of someone local that can help.

    http://www.arrowheadreptilerescue.org/Web/about/

    It also wouldn't hurt to at least call some vets and tell them the situation. I have heard of some vets offering their services at a discount for rescued animals. It won't hurt to try. And they also may know of some local rescues that may be able to help.

    Hopefully this boa can be saved. Good luck, and thank you for getting it out of the cold. I would also suggest keeping it away from your other reptiles.
